The Burger and Morkel families released the first Roodekrantz wines in 2015. Committed to preserving ancient Certified Old Vine Heritage Vineyards, they work closely with their growers, encouraging respectful and sustainable vineyard practices. No new oak ensures the quality of the fruit and terroir shine through in every bottle.
The Rhenosterbosrug is a sensational Chenin Blanc hailing from old Swartland vines planted in 1983. It is absolutely jam-packed with rich aromas of apricots, peaches and orchard fruits alongside distinct floral hints. The palate is seriously complex and satisfying with pure fruit flavours and a long, fragrant finish.
Part of a superb line up of Old Vine Project-certified wines from Roodekrantz, this Swartland Chenin Blanc hails from a Swartland parcel planted in 1983. Perfumed and stony, it has understated oak, leesy intensity, peach and citrus flavours and good weight for a wine with 12.6% alcohol.
